Output 26601496b197a5ff1fab981d17b083b7cab66a53d2d3dd0c73781f30c77e4e84:8

value
181332823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38e0b9d217d0d68407f341850af939e0832b1f8 OP_EQUAL
address
MW6xbXhNd6cKr1PVDLeyg1scsK7P7RJsAE
transaction
26601496b197a5ff1fab981d17b083b7cab66a53d2d3dd0c73781f30c77e4e84
spent
true